Key Responsibilities

  • Act as the main point of contact for residents throughout the programme of works.

  • Communicate project information, work schedules, and access requirements to residents.

  • Arrange appointments, conduct resident visits, and hold pre-start meetings.

  • Manage resident expectations and resolve any queries or complaints professionally.

  • Liaise closely with site managers, supervisors, client representatives, and subcontractors.

  • Support vulnerable residents and ensure appropriate measures are in place throughout the works.

  • Maintain accurate records of resident communications, appointments, and project updates.

  • Attend site and client meetings, providing feedback on resident concerns and customer satisfaction.

  • Promote a high standard of customer care and help ensure projects are delivered on time.
